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ta Ingredients
• Here’s everything you need to create your creamy masterpiece!
For the Sauce
- Garlic Cloves – 8 cloves, minced; ensures a robust flavor profile!
- Cherry Tomatoes – 3 cups, halved; substitute with canned tomatoes if fresh are unavailable.
- Olive Oil – 4 tablespoons; adds richness and helps sauté the garlic perfectly.
- Dry White Wine – 1 cup; for complexity—use vegetable broth to keep it non-alcoholic.
- White Sugar – 1 teaspoon; balances the acidity of the tomatoes beautifully.
- Chili Flakes – 1 teaspoon; adjust to taste or replace with black pepper for a milder kick.
- Tomato Paste – 2 tablespoons; optional, but intensifies the tomato flavor superbly.
- Heavy Cream – 2 cups; the heart of the richness in this sauce—use full-fat coconut milk for a dairy-free option.
- Flour – 1 tablespoon; thickens the sauce; consider cornstarch mixed with water for a gluten-free alternative.
- Chopped Parsley – ½ cup; lends a fresh note and brightens the dish.
- Smoked Paprika – 1 teaspoon; brings a smoky depth that elevates the sauce.
- Garlic Powder – 1 teaspoon; enhances the garlic flavor, though fresh garlic suffices as an alternative.
- Salt & Pepper – For seasoning; essential for enhancing the overall flavor.
For the Pasta
- Rigatoni Pasta – 8 oz, cooked al dente for the best texture and sauce adherence.
For Garnishing (Optional)
- Freshly Grated Parmesan – Adds an extra layer of creaminess and flavor; use generously!

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ta Recipe
Step 1: Prep Ingredients
Begin by mincing 8 garlic cloves and halving 3 cups of cherry tomatoes. Place the minced garlic in a bowl and the halved tomatoes on a cutting board for easy access. These fresh ingredients will form the base of your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ta, making sure everything is ready before you start cooking.
Step 2: Sauté Garlic
Heat 4 tablespoons of olive oil in a large pan over medium heat. Once the oil shimmers, add the minced garlic along with a pinch of salt. Sauté for about 5 minutes until the garlic is golden and fragrant, stirring occasionally to prevent burning. This step is crucial for infusing the oil with delicious garlic flavor for your sauce.
Step 3: Cook Tomatoes
Add the halved cherry tomatoes to the pan, along with a pinch of salt to enhance their sweetness. Sauté the mixture for 10-15 minutes, stirring gently until the tomatoes soften and start to release their juices. This caramelization process will deepen the flavors, making your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ta irresistibly good!
Step 4: Deglaze
Pour in 1 cup of dry white wine to deglaze the pan,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om. Let the wine simmer for about 5 minutes, allowing the alcohol to cook off. Then, add 1 teaspoon of chili flakes and 2 tablespoons of tomato paste, stirring well to incorporate all the flavors into the sauce.
Step 5: Add Cream
Reduce the heat to low and stir in 2 cups of heavy cream, creating a rich and creamy sauce. In a small bowl, mix 1 tablespoon of flour with a splash of water to form a slurry, then add it to the pan. Cook for another 5-10 minutes, stirring gently until the sauce has thickened to your desired consistency.
Step 6: Season and Combine
Mix in ½ cup of chopped parsley, 1 teaspoon of smoked paprika, 1 teaspoon of garlic powder, and ad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per to taste. Once seasoned, gently incorporate the cooked rigatoni pasta into the sauce, ensuring each piece is well-coated in the creamy, tomato-infused mixture.
Step 7: Finish Cooking
Allow the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ta to simmer for an additional 5 minutes on low heat, then cover and let sit for 5 more minutes. This resting time allows the flavors to meld together beautifully, enhancing the overall taste of your delectable pasta dish.
Step 8: Serve
To serve, dish out the pasta into bowls and garnish with freshly grated Parmesan cheese, extra parsley, and a sprinkle of black pepper for added flavor. This comforting meal is now ready to be enjoyed, bringing the warmth and richness of homemade food right to your table!

How to Store and Freeze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ta
Fridge: Store any le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Keep it tightly sealed to maintain freshness and flavor.
Freezer: For long-term storage, transfer cooled pasta to a freezer-safe container. It keeps well for up to 2 months. When ready to enjoy, th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.
Reheating: To restore the creamy texture, reheat gently on the stovetop over low heat. Add a splash of cream or water as needed to loosen the sauce and make it velvety again.
Room Temperature: Avoid leaving this dish at room temperature for more than 2 hours to ensure food safety.
Make Ahead Options
These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ta preparations are perfect for busy home cooks looking to save time during the week! You can prep the sauce (minus the cream) up to 3 days in advance; simply sauté the garlic and tomatoes, deglaze, and season. Store this mixture in an airtight container in the refrigerator. When ready to serve, reheat the sauce in a pan, add the heavy cream, and let it simmer for about 5-10 minutes to thicken. For optimal quality, stir in the freshly cooked rigatoni just before serving to ensure the pasta maintains its perfect texture, giving you that delicious homemade feel with minimal effort!

Expert Tips for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ta
- Garlic Care: Always sauté garlic until golden and fragrant, but be cautious; burnt garlic will impart a bitter taste to your sauce.
- Wine Substitute: If you prefer a non-alcoholic option, use vegetable broth instead of dry white wine to maintain depth without compromising flavor.
- Thickening Tricks: For a thicker sauce, simply simmer for a longer time on low heat. If needed, mix in a flour slurry to achieve the desired consistency.
- Taste Test: Regularly taste as you cook, especially when adjusting seasoning. Different wines can alter the final flavor, so adjust salt and pepper accordingly.
- Pasta Choice: Use rigatoni for best sauce adherence, but feel free to experiment with gluten-free alternatives or shapes that you love, keeping the essence of this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ta intact.
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ta Variations
Feel free to let your creativity shine as you customize this recipe to fit your tastes and dietary needs!
- Gluten-Free: Use chickpea or lentil pasta for a hearty, gluten-free option that still delivers great flavor.
- Dairy-Free Delight: Substitute heavy cream with full-fat coconut milk for a rich, creamy texture without dairy.
- Veggie Boost: Incorporate fresh spinach or kale to sneak in some nutrition and color; they wilt beautifully into the sauce.
- Heat It Up: Mix in diced jalapeños or a splash of hot sauce to elevate the spice level to your preferences.
- Extra Protein: Add grilled chicken or shrimp for an irresistible protein punch that complements the creamy sauce perfectly.
- Herb Swap: Fresh basil can replace parsley for a fresh twist! It adds a sweet, aromatic flavor that brightens the dish.
- Citrus Zing: A squeeze of lemon juice just before serving brightens flavors and adds a refreshing citrus note.
- Smoky Twist: For depth, experiment with smoked goat cheese or feta to give the sauce an extra smoky flavor that’s truly unique.

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ta Recipe FAQs
How do I pick the best cherry tomatoes for this recipe?
Absolutely! When choosing cherry tomatoes, look for those that are bright and firm, with no dark spots or blemishes. The best ones have a rich, sweet aroma—this indicates freshness. If they’re slightly squishy, they may be overripe, but a few small imperfections shouldn’t deter you, as long as they still feel robust.
What’s the best way to store leftovers of this pasta?
Great question!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ator, where they’ll stay fresh for up to 3 days. Make sure to seal the container tightly to lock in that creamy goodness. When ready to enjoy, gently reheat on the stovetop, adding a splash of cream or water to restore the original texture.
Can I freeze this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ta?
Yes, you can! To freeze, let the pasta cool completely and then transfer it to a freezer-safe container. It can be stored for up to 2 months. When you’re ready to eat, just thaw it in the fridge overnight. Reheat on low heat in a pan, adding in a little cream or water if the sauce seems too thick.
What should I do if my sauce is too thin?
If you find your sauce is too thin, no worries! To thicken it up, you can create a slurry by mixing 1 tablespoon of flour with a little water, and then stir it into your sauce while it simmers. Let it cook for an additional few minutes, and the sauce should thicken up beautifully. Alternatively, simmer the sauce uncovered on low heat for a longer period to reduce it.
Is this recipe suitable for those with dietary restrictions?
Certainly! You can easily modify this Easy and Creamy Tomato Garlic Pasta recipe for various dietary needs. For a gluten-free version, substitute rigatoni with gluten-free pasta, and replace the flour with cornstarch mixed with water. For a dairy-free option, consider using full-fat coconut milk in place of heavy cream. Always adjust ingredients based on personal allergies and preferences!
Can I prepare this dish ahead of time?
Absolutely, you can prep a lot of the components ahead! Mince the garlic and halve the cherry tomatoes a day in advance, storing them separately in the fridge. You can also cook the rigatoni and toss it with a bit of olive oil to prevent sticking. Just assemble everything and heat when you’re ready for a quick, delicious dinner.
